Community
Participate
Working Groups
When creating a Connector between Port elements, the ConnectorEnd::partWithPort property is not correctly filled in. This is a side effect from the following EditPolicyProvider declared in ClassDiagram plug-in and remaining active even when the active diagram is not a ClassDiagram (this results in the custom GRAPH_NODE_ROLE edit policy being ignored on Port). <extension point="org.eclipse.gmf.runtime.diagram.ui.editpolicyProviders"> <editpolicyProvider class="org.eclipse.papyrus.diagram.clazz.custom.providers.CustomEditPolicyProvider"> <Priority name="Highest"> </Priority> </editpolicyProvider> </extension>
Seems to be corrected (tested in r519).